Since I've been sporting some icy blonde hues lately, I thought I would give this EVO Fabuloso Platinum Blonde Colour intensifier a try.  I usually use the Beige blonde (and LOVE it) so I knew purchasing this one wasn't going to be too much of a risk.  It's about $37 dollars per bottle but totally worth it.  I was so happy to see my icy hues return after noticing that they were beginning to fade two weeks after getting my hair done at the salon.  So for me - this is a super solution.
They also included a detangling comb and the 'fingers' on it are so nice and big that I'm going to use it every time I get out of the shower!  Hope all of you beautiful blondes out there will enjoy EVO as much as I have!

I was getting really upset with the latest version of Lancome.  I found it really heavy and thick almost to the point where I couldnt rub it into my face without giving myself a full massage and they changed the scent which had me a little miffed as well.  So, I decided to go ahead and try out a new (very highly recommended) brand called Caudalie from Paris France.  

Upon the first use of the L'Elixir which is the oil that you smooth onto your face before you put on the cream, I fell in love.  I also started noticing the skin on my face was super soft and really smooth so I decided to give the Premier Cru Creme at try.  Within a week of trying the duo, I am totally hooked.  You can buy the product online at www.geebeauty.ca  .  If you're looking for help to rejuvenate dry drab skin, this is seriously going to be your key.  What I also love about Gee Beauty is that they send two, sometimes three other beauty samples in your shipment to try.  It's not always stuff that you can buy at say Sephora, so it feels exclusive and special even though the products are probably available to all European women at their local drugstore.  


NO PARABENES!  This is huge to me and really important in all of my makeup products.  You pay more but I am happy to do so.

1. Kiehl's Ultra Facial Overnight Hydrating Masque
2. Kiehl's Ultra Facial Cleanser
3. Kiehl's Ultra Facial Toner

1. I enjoyed the hydrating masque.  In our climate it can be so dry that I resort to putting vaseline on my face overnight.  This was a lovely alternative.  It was not sticky or greasy and my skin absorbed it almost immediately so there was zero residue on my pillowcase.  Woke up with ULTRA (haha) soft skin.  Product is almost scent free which I liked
10/10

2.Very mild cleanser.  I almost felt like it didn't quite get everything off of my face.  I have very sensitive skin and this was gentle and did not strip my skin.  Product is semi scent free - smells like warm laundry fresh out of the dryer.  
9.5/10

3. I've always been told that I need to use a toner - literally the Clinique cosmetics lady behind the counter pushed one on me when I was around 16 years old!  But the truth is, I don't really know what they do, or do for you.  I don't notice a different in my skin being 'evened out' or 'refined' after use so for that reason, I don't always buy toners or use them.  This one however is made with Avocado and Kernel oil so almost like a moisturizer it was soft and luscious after use.
9/10

Helen of Troy Gold Series 1-1/2" Curling Iron
$50 at Sally Beauty Shop

I wanted to give a larger barrel a try.  This one has a heat setting all the way up to 420 degrees.  
The large barrel is quick to heat up and stays hot as long as you have it plugged in - so you need to 
watch that you don't leave it sitting out and 'on'.  

Results:  I like how hot it can get but I did burn my finger on the very first attempt.  It is a bit on the heavy side.  When I bought it, I was told that I would need to hold the curl for at least 15-20 seconds - a bit of an arm workout.  I still prefer my Conair silver metal curling iron because of the barrel metal, for some reason it just works better with my hair.  However the size of this Helen of Troy barrel gives me the large wavy curls that I was looking for.  I'll probably use both irons on special days and my smaller one on a daily basis.  
8/10
